Letter from John Ball Sr. to his Son John Ball Jr., October 21, 1798

- Description:
- A letter from John Ball Sr. in Charleston, South Carolina to his son John Ball Jr. at Harvard College in Massachusetts discussing their fears of John Ball Jr. getting yellow fever in Boston, Uncle Ball sick with fever, John Ball Jr.'s friends "Allston and Wainwright" at university, John attending class with "67 scholars," and the importance of an education.
